By 2017, Ice Cube was more than a rapper or movie star; he was a diversified business operator. His net worth reflected long term compounding of music royalties, backend movie deals, and strategic brand partnerships that extended well beyond the screen and speakers.
Public valuation estimates placed his net worth near $160 million in 2017, supported by recurring income from a deep catalog and a slate of films that remained relevant through syndication and streaming. This base allowed him to invest further in ventures aligned with his brand and community interests.
Music Catalog and Publishing Income
Long Term Revenue from Recording Assets
Ice Cube music catalog generated substantial passive income by 2017, driven by classic albums, streaming growth, and licensing for commercials, films, and gaming. The enduring popularity of tracks like It Was a Good Day ensured consistent royalty streams.
Publishing deals and ownership stakes in his lyrics and compositions amplified earnings beyond performance royalties, turning older recordings into reliable profit centers year after year. Rights management through Cubic Productions helped him capture value that many artists miss.
Film Backend and Box Office Impact
Earnings from Major Movie Roles
His film roles, including the Boyz n the Hood era and later ensemble hits, often included backend compensation that became lucrative as films performed well on home video and streaming. By 2017, those long tail payments were a meaningful portion of his income.
Projects anchored around family friendly franchises and urban comedies broadened his audience, which in turn strengthened negotiating power for profit participation and residual payouts. The ongoing cultural relevance of these movies supported stable earnings.
